Thankfully nobody died!!!!!!!!!!!!!
Guys here are the pics from my nephews accident the other night. When you look at the back seat keep in mind that the twin boys in the back were both over 300 lbs. One broke two vertebrae and one broke his pelvis. It will be a long road back for both, but thankfully they will make a full recovery.
My nephew is over 6 ft and 250 lbs as well and he was driving. He will have to have some surgery on his face and nose, not to mention possible serious dealings with the law for speeeding. I am thankful that these are really good kids and NO drugs or alcohol was involved. This still has me shaken up and both mad and sad. Love the ones you are with and the ones you aren't with, call them and tell them you love them!!

Update on the kids from the car....
My nephew is gonna have to have two surgeries to fix his nose and sinus cavity. Physically he will recover totally mentally I am not sure if that will happen. He did get to see the twin in the hospital yesterday for the first time. He visited with them and their parents and grandparents for about two hours. Everyone was in great spirits and there was alot of hugging and smiles. The boy with the broken neck may be released as early as Wednesday, which is great news. The other boy has at least two more weeks in the hospital and then another two or three months bed ridden. They have no idea how lucky they really are, thank goodness someone or something was looking down on them.
